What were the traditions and beliefs of medieval thinkers?
Andre45 [30]

Medieval philosophy is characterized for its heavy focus on theology, discussing topics such as the <em>problem of evil</em>, the <em>problem of free will</em>, <em>faith</em>, <em>the existence of God</em>, <em>the human soul</em>, and <em>immortality of the intellect</em>.

In Medieval times, Thinkers were devoted Christians who dedicated their lives on the search for the truth.
